'I almost died': Former Love Island star Shelby Bilby reveals she got food poisoning after Married At First Sight star and best friend Ashley Irvin cooked for her

Former Love Island star Shelby Bilby has revealed she 'almost died' at the hands of her best friend, Ashley Irvin. 

Taking to her Instagram Stories, the reality star, 27, shared a snap of herself looking worse for wear on Monday. 

'#Notwell @ashletyairvin cooked dinner last night and I got food poisoning. Been vomiting all night and morning. I take back wifing her, probably don’t!’ Shelby captioned the post.

Shelby then reposted videos that were shared to Ashley's Instagram, which included a detailed account of the girls' night.

'Can I just say I didn't know I gave Shelby food poisoning,' the 31-year-old star said with a laugh. 'Poor girl was vomiting all night log and half the time...'

Before Shelby interjected, 'She wasn't even awake! She was sleeping through it the whole time! I wasn't even being dramatic I could've died.'

Meanwhile, Ashley continued to giggle as she told Instagram fans she was 'dead asleep' during the ordeal and woke up to ask Shelby if she wanted to go to the hospital.
